April 21, 2023Charles PonziYou've heard of a Ponzi Scheme. Lots of multi-millionaires and billionaires have been in the news for running Ponzi schemes and getting sent to prison. Well, this episode covers the man that the scheme is named after. Charles Ponzi had $2.50 cents when he arrived in America in the early 1900s. He had even less when he left 30 something years later, but in the time that he was in America, he conned thousands of people out of millions of dollars. This is the story of how he did it. March 29, 2023Dean and Tina ClouseIn 1980, a young couple from Florida moved to Texas in search of a better job opportunity. Just a few months later, their family quit receiving letters from them. The family in Florida was visited by a religious group that told them the young couple had joined their group and was cutting out their family, so they would never hear from them again.40 years later...the family learned that the young couple were the unidentified victim's of a gruesome murder scene in Texas in 1980.When the family found out, their first question was, "What about the baby?"Along the way, several organizations including a popular true crime podcast network, Audiochuck (Crime Junkies, Counter Clock, Red Ball...many, many more) got involved to help fund the search for answers, from genealogy testing to spreading the word through social media.
